Télécharger Imprimer la page

Sharp PC-1500 Manuel D'instructions page 46

Publicité

Ali
and more about Sharp
PC-1500
at http://www.PC-1500.info
Touche utilisées:
CDOOŒJCD
1
=
l(]J
ls•<nl
CJŒJCD
1=
1
OO
ISH•HI
c:J
ŒJ
rn
1
:
l[j[J
1
ENTER!
rnoomrnrnrnrn1
.....
1
~moornoomrn
1~c•irn
lss>•œl
ŒJŒJ
Œ)
I
B
l
(J[)OOŒJI
SHOFTI
~
l'"•FTIŒJ
rn rn
1
.....
1mŒJm1
...
,
..
,
m
ŒD
rn
l••«•I
rn
oorn1
=1
mŒJrnrn
oo
rnrnoo
rn
mm
rn
1·~·1
m r n œ
o:J1=
IODo:JBrnl
••11
1
IO[[)illl
=
IŒJ
ffiGOO
'
'"'"
'
c:J[[)
QJI
=
IOOCD
Gffi
l••TEAI
rn oo
rn rn
1
=
1
œ rn
rn
œ
rn
œ
œ
rn
1
.....
1
ŒJ
OOŒJOD
COŒJCîJI
SKlfrl
~(]]
IJD
OO
OO
!Il
ISP•e<I
mm
m
1
...
•c•1
mm rn rn m mm
ŒJ
rn
m
m
1=
11 .,.•c•.I
1SHlFT
Ic::J1
""'"
'
CJ !Il
QD
l•••••
I
Notez
que chaque
ligne
du programme effectue une opération complète et
nécessaire.
La
ligne
10
efface
toutes
les
valeurs que
les
variables
Nl, N2 et N3 auraient
pu contenir jusqu'à
présent
{une- précaution destinêe
à
prévoir
le c
as
l'utilisateur oublierait
d'entrer
les
3
nornbres)
.
La
lign<?
20
recueille
les
donnés de
l'utilisateur.
La
ligne
30 fait
la
moyenne
des nombres.
La
ligne
40
calcule
les
différences.
La
ligne
50
fait
la somrne
des différences et
la ligne
60
imprime
le
résultat.
Les
instructions
de chaque
ligne
ne correspondent pas accidentellement
à
la
description
en
langage
courant
du programme.
Bien au contraire, c'est en accordance avec
les
principes de la
bonne programmation,
principes
que nous
essayons
de
vous inculquer.
A
la
différence
de l'utilisation des
abréviations, l'utilisation
du double·point a un
effet
sur
la
quantité de mémoire utilisée pour
stocker le
programme.
Voilà
la raison
principale
de
l'utilisation
du
double·point
pour placer plusieurs
instruclions
sur
la
même ligne.
Chaque
numéro de
ligne
réserve
plusieurs "phases" !unité de mémoire) de programme et
par
conséquent,
moins
il
y a de
lignes
dans un programme,
moins
on
occupe
de
mémoire
dans
ce
programme.
En conclusion, nous dirons, au sujet
de
l'emploi
du
double·point, que
chaque programmeur
devra garder
un
équilibre
entre la
lisibilité
et
la
flexibilité
du
programme
et
la
mémoire nécessaire
pour son application.
J.
La correction d'erreurs sur le mode PROgramme
Quoique les
abréviations et
les
double·points nous facilitènt
l'éntléé
dés
ptôgtàmm<!s, ils
ne
peuvent
empêcher
même
les
meilleurs
d'entfe nous de
faire des
erreu rs.
Même les programmeurs
professionnels
ne
réussissent pas
à
découvrir
leurs
propres erreufs
quand ils passent en
revue
leurs
programmes. Nous voulons dire
pa
r là
que tôt ou tard vous rencontrerez une
erreur pendant
ou
après
le
passage de votre programm:e. En général
ces erreurs
peuvent
être
corrigées facilement,
si
vous
les
considérei
comme
part d'une énigme
à
résoudre
et
si
vous
localisez
le
problème soigneuse·
ment.
Vous
serez
aidé
dans
cette tache par plusieurs caractéristiques du PC·1500. Quand le
SHARP
rencontre
une
instruction
incorrecte,
il
interrompt
ses opérations
et
vous
ind
ique,
le
problème
avec
un message laconique: comme
le
suivant.
RUN
ERROR
1
IN
20
44
Do not
sale
this PDF
!!!

Publicité

loading